What is the Overdraft Protection Notice?

The Overdraft Protection Notice is a crucial form that informs account holders about their options regarding overdraft protection on their bank accounts. This form serves the essential function of detailing how overdraft protection works and what fees may apply, particularly with iQ Credit Union's standard practices.
This notice includes a definition of overdraft protection and outlines its role in managing account balances. It is important for account holders to realize that their signature on this document signifies their consent or denial of these services, making it a critical component of account management.

Purpose and Benefits of the Overdraft Protection Notice

The Overdraft Protection Notice is vital for account holders aiming to understand the advantages of opting into overdraft protection. By choosing to participate, account holders can prevent declined transactions, which can be both inconvenient and costly.
Opting out may lead to potential fees and issues associated with insufficient funds. Understanding the details surrounding overdraft fees and the necessary opt-in criteria empowers account holders to make informed financial decisions.
